Quick Summary

The U.S. Coast Guard (USCG) Base New Orleans has issued a combined synopsis/solicitation for the cleaning and inspection of the oily waste tank onboard the USCGC Saginaw (WLIC 803). This requirement supports the vessel's scheduled dockside maintenance period in New Orleans, LA. This is a Total Small Business Set-Aside resulting in a Firm-Fixed Price contract awarded to the quoter providing the Lowest Price. Quotes are due by February 27, 2026.

Scope of Work

The contractor shall provide all labor, materials, and equipment to perform the following:

  • Tank Cleaning: Remove approximately 100 gallons of waste oil and oily water; clean interior surfaces free of sediment and sludge without damaging coatings.
  • Inspection: Conduct a visual inspection of all interior surfaces, including bulkheads, plating, manhole covers, fasteners, and gasket seating surfaces. Assess the condition of the Tank Level Indicator (TLI), float switches, and sounding tubes.
  • Waste Disposal: Dispose of all fluids and cleaning waste in accordance with federal, state, and local regulations, maintaining a complete chain of custody record.
  • Testing & Documentation: Witness operational tests of TLIs and submit a "Tank and Void Assessment Form" via Coast Guard reporting systems.
